The launch of the first floating exhibition for commercial concession in Jeddah with the participation of 24 countries

Under the umbrella of the Saudi Chambers, the National Commercial Concession Committee is preparing for the first international exhibition for commercial concession, on May 5, 2025, from the city of Jeddah.
The exhibition witnesses the participation of representatives from 24 countries from different continents of the world, including an elite group of investors, businessmen, implemented and parking for commercial concession, in an event that is the first of its kind at the level of idea, implementation and international participation.
The exhibition aims to enhance the attendance of Saudi brands in the global markets, and to create an innovative platform to display success stories and distinguished national models in the commercial concession sector, in addition to attracting qualitative investment opportunities from abroad towards the Saudi market.

The goals of the exhibition

The goals of the exhibition include: enabling Saudi brands to regional and international expansion, and enhance communication and integration between local and international investors.
The goals of the exhibition include: providing an interactive platform to introduce the culture of commercial concession and best global practices.
The exhibition’s goals include: supporting the Kingdom’s 2030 vision targets by diversifying sources of income and increasing the contribution of the private sector to the national economy.
Dr. Khaled Al -Ghamdi, Chairman of the National Commercial Excellence Committee, the exhibition represents a qualitative shift in organizing specialized events.
He added: This floating exhibition embodies the image of the modern Kingdom as a leading destination for investment and innovation, and highlights the competitiveness of Saudi marks in global markets. The choice of a marine ship to hold the exhibition reflects our desire to present an exceptional experience and outside the traditional frameworks in organizing business.
The event is expected to form a strategic station to support entrepreneurs and startups, and enhances the Kingdom’s tendency towards building a diversified and sustainable economy, based on knowledge, technology and entrepreneurship.
